Ireland’s Role in the Tech Landscape: A Shift Towards Accountability

In recent times, Ireland has emerged as a prominent destination for global technology firms, lured by its attractive tax incentives adn supportive business climate. Though, with increasing scrutiny on major tech companies worldwide, there are growing concerns about weather Ireland will maintain its accommodating stance or adopt a more proactive approach to regulation and accountability.This article examines the intricate dynamics of Ireland’s relationship with large tech corporations and considers the potential ramifications of its policies amid rising demands for reform from both local advocates and international organizations. As various stakeholders evaluate the trade-off between economic benefits and ethical responsibilities, a crucial question arises: Will Ireland continue to be seen as an ally of Big Tech or is it ready to embrace a new era of digital governance?

Ireland’s Shifting Role in Tech Regulation

As regulatory frameworks across Europe become increasingly stringent regarding digital platforms, Ireland stands at a pivotal juncture where it must balance its status as a base for American tech giants against mounting calls for enhanced oversight. The emergence of issues such as data breaches, misinformation campaigns, and monopolistic practices underscores the urgent need for effective enforcement mechanisms. The data Protection Commission (DPC) in Ireland has faced criticism over its slow response times and perceived leniency towards thes corporations—prompting some observers to question whether it acts merely as an enabler rather than an effective regulator. To strengthen its regulatory framework, Ireland may need to reevaluate how it engages with these companies while aligning itself with EU initiatives like the Digital services Act aimed at bolstering accountability.

The current environment presents both obstacles and opportunities for Irish policymakers who must not only enforce compliance but also reshape narratives that position their country as a leader in regulatory practices. Key strategies that could facilitate this conversion include:

  • Enhancing transparency within decision-making processes.
  • Boosting resources allocated to regulatory agencies such as the DPC.
  • Cultivating partnerships with international regulators to standardize practices.

By implementing these strategies effectively, Ireland can shift perceptions from being merely an enabler of tech excesses towards becoming an influential player committed to shaping responsible digital governance characterized by accountability and ethical standards.

Regulatory Hurdles and Pathways to Accountability

The changing landscape of digital regulation within Ireland brings forth significant challenges alongside promising opportunities aimed at enhancing accountability within the technology sector. Regulators are tasked with striking a delicate balance between fostering innovation while safeguarding consumer rights—a complex endeavor given issues surrounding data privacy, adherence to EU general Data Protection Regulation (GDPR), along with enforcing policies that adapt swiftly amidst evolving online content dynamics. Moreover, hosting numerous European headquarters for major tech firms raises questions about whether existing regulations sufficiently hold these entities accountable for their societal impacts.

This challenging environment also opens doors for significant reforms; one promising direction involves establishing clear guidelines mandating transparency regarding algorithms used by tech companies along with data handling practices—empowering users through better understanding how decisions are made within these organizations. Additionally, engaging diverse stakeholders—including civil society members—can provide valuable insights into policy growth reflecting varied perspectives across communities affected by technological advancements. Implementing robust self-regulatory mechanisms alongside regular compliance evaluations could further enhance accountability throughout this ecosystem.
